Pediatric Advil Dosing Charts

Please check with your physician, or their nurse before administering any medications to your child. Please read all prescribing information that accompanies any medications before administration. It is more accurate to dose medications by weight than age if at all possible. Please call our office if you have any questions regarding this or any other medications.
